It's tiny, I know. But a it's a start. I would love to get a list going of all the brands from Latin America that lean toward the "healthy," like seasoning packages without MSG and the like.
I mention MSG because it's in a popular flavor enhancer used in products common in every day cooking, like powdered chicken bouillon.
MSG is controversial. Some say it's dangerous, others that it's harmless. But it is for certain related to weight gain (path to a list of illness I don't want), so maybe I'll just avoid it and let the debate rage on without me.
How does MSG make you fat?
"Like aspartame, MSG is an excitotoxin, a substance that overexcites neurons to the point of cell damage and, eventually, cell death...MSG creates a lesion in the hypothalamus that correlates with abnormal development, including obesity, short stature and sexual reproduction problems." - Natural News.com
I'm checking my labels.
